-Choose a group, choose a sketch-
You can pick ANY sketch from the http://www.sketchsupport.com website. You can pick a single side of the double sketches from the website for the single page groups or double a single page sketch for the 2-page layout groups..
Here are the Guidelines:

-Titles – you get lots of leeway here. They can be store bought, cut or printed. If printed they should be matted – printed paper, one layer under. They can be literal – park, ride or character’s name or they can be something that invokes the feeling of the subject you chose. “Oh Boy” –Mickey, “Get Wet” –Splash Mountain, “Pixie Dust” –Tinkerbelle, you get the idea.

-You are allowed to rotate the sketch/map in any direction you want.

-You may use one side of the two page sketches for the single page groups. Just be sure there is a place for the title and journal box included if not shown on that side of the sketch in addition to the photo mats.

-You may use a single sketch and mirror or make a page that flows with it for the two page groups.
Note: – Must have at least 1 photo mat, journal box and title for single page groups. Must have at least 3 photo mats, journal box and title for double page groups.

-Some of the sketches may seem very simple. I am giving you the liberty to embellish extra or add extra layers. It should resemble the sketch in number, size and placement of photos along with the journaling being in the same general area. Most sketches have examples of them being used on her website.

-Where the sketch has an edge or a shape, please use an edge or a shape. They do not have to be as shown. If it shows wavy, you may substitute eyelet, waterfall, torn, etc. If it shows a die cut, you can use any kind of die cut such as scallop circle/square, road sign, etc.

-Please use a layer of cardstock as your base. You may completely cover it with thinner paper. It is very difficult to sort them when they bend and sometimes the embellishments get caught.

-Please use quality paper on your layouts. If the patterned paper doesn't have a name printed on it, don't use it. Paper must be name brand. [this shouldn’t be a problem because most Disney themed paper is a name brand and all solid colors at JoAnn’s, Hobby Lobby, Michael’s and Archiver’s is already name brand]

-You are not required to double mat your elements or have to embellish the elements one/two way. Use your judgment on what looks best.

-You must use paper that matches your layout for photo placement. This is so swappers can cut their photos to give it a mat if they choose.

-You may use a solid sheet for some of the photo placements where it does not show spacing between them. Scoring for size is nice, but not a requirement.

-Please be sure the paper used for the journal section can be written on. The bling at JoAnn's is terrible. I didn't know that until just recently. Sorry for using it on some layouts previously.

-You may use any kind of embellishment you like on these sketches where they are indicated or in place of a “layer” of paper. Ribbon and fiber are good substitutions for paper layers. Bulky and dimensional embellishments are encouraged.

-If it shows a large embellishment, please use a large one or several small ones in that area. If it shows 3 embellishments scattered, please use at least that many or one long to span the area.

-You may use different embellishments and paper on each of your layouts. Please ensure they are of the same quality.

-More than one of the same sketch can be in the same group. We did groups using the same sketch last time and they were all different looking inside the same group. You can change your sketch at any time during the swap making, no permission is needed. I trust you all to make the right choices for your themes.

-If the sketch has a date/event/place or anything more than a title, leave that area blank. These can be added by the members after they receive the pages.

-Please put the sketch number on the back of your layout. From the single page group - #A, from double page group - #B. Use the same numbers on her website for ease of finding later.

-Please double check your pages to be sure they stay stuck together. We have had adhesive failure in the past and it makes it difficult to sort them when they are falling apart.
